DAN GONZALEZ
Executive Vice President and Regional Manager
Dan is responsible for overseeing the Scheer Partners, Inc. Virginia
office. He has nearly 15 years of commercial real estate experience. He
has managed and executed complex projects consisting of strategic
planning/consulting, leasing and sales, financing, and development. Dan
has completed over 4 million square feet of local, national and
international transactions with a cumulative value of in excess of $2.5
Billion Dollars.
Dan is a member of the Northern Virginia Technology Council’s (www.nvtc.org),
Executive Committee and Board of Directors. Dan was a founding board
member of the Washington DC Technology Council (www.dctechcouncil.org).
Former Virginia Governor Mark Warner appointed Dan to the Virginia
Biotechnology Advisory Board developed to foster biotech investment
within Virginia and to the Virginia Joint Commission on Technology &
Science (JCOTS) Nanotechnology Advisory Committee. Dan is on the board
of the Virginia Biotechnology Association (www.vabio.org)
and a co-founder of Northern Virginia Biosciences Executives Group. He
serves as an advisor to angel venture capital fund Amplifier Ventures (www.amplifierventurea.com)
and Security One Bank (www.s1bank.com)
Dan also supports youth development by serving as a business plan judge
for the National Foundation for Teaching Entrepreneurship (www.nfte.com)
and as a scholarship applicant reviewer for the Hispanic College Fund (www.hispanicfund.org).
He is Chairman of the Equal Footing Foundation (www.efooting.or)
formerly the NVTC Foundation) which is an organization aimed at
promoting community development through technology.
Dan received his MBA from the Carey School of Business at Johns Hopkins
University with a focus on finance and decision science. He received his
Bachelor of Science from Old Dominion University. He resides in McLean,
Virginia with his wife and two children (soon to be three).
